One of four children of Mary & Tony, slaves of Robert Waid and Nancy Welch Lackey. Even though the location of these graves have been know and kept up for years, the names of three of the children are not know. Little Joe was the exception. He was the last of the family to die. He went in search for cattle one day, and was caught in a violent storm. He was fatally killed in the storm. Searcher later found his body with all the clothing stipped from his body. The mountain where he was found became known as Naked Joe Mountain. Later when application was made for a post office near the location, the name of Naked Joe was submitted, and the postal department changed it to Old Joe. The Post Office, Mountain, and surrounding community became known as Old Joe and Old Joe Mountain as a lasting memorial to Little Joe.

The birthdate is unknown, and death date was around 1863.
